How To Install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s on Kali Linux
Introduction
In this tutorial we learn how to install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s on Kali Linux.
What is n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s
n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s is:
This metapackage depends on the NVIDIA binary libraries that provide optimized hardware acceleration of OpenGL/GLX/EGL/GLES applications via a direct-rendering X Server.
There are three methods to install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s on Kali Linux. We can use apt-get, apt and aptitude. In the following sections we will describe each method. You can choose one of them.
Install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s Using apt-get
Update apt database with apt-get using the following command.
sudo apt-get updateAfter updating apt database, We can install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s using apt-get by running the following command:
sudo apt-get -y install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libsInstall n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s Using apt
Update apt database with apt using the following command.
sudo apt updateAfter updating apt database, We can install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s using apt by running the following command:
sudo apt -y install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libsInstall n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s Using aptitude
If you want to follow this method, you might need to install aptitude on Kali Linux first since aptitude is usually not installed by default on Kali Linux. Update apt database with aptitude using the following command.
sudo aptitude updateAfter updating apt database, We can install nvidia-tesla-460-driver-libs using aptitude by running the following command:
